Overcome negative thought patterns, reduce stress, and live a worry-free life. Overthinking is a major cause of unhappiness. Don't get stuck in a never-ending thought loop. Stay present and keep your mind off things that don't matter and never will. Break free from your self-imposed mental prison. "Stop Overthinking" is a book that understands your exhausting situation and how you can lose your mind in the trap of anxiety and stress. Acclaimed author Nick Trenton will guide you through the obstacles with detailed and proven techniques to help you rewire your brain, control your thoughts, and change your mental habits. The book provides scientific approaches to completely change the way you think and feel about yourself by ending vicious thought patterns. Stop agonizing over the past and trying to predict the future.

Nick Trenton grew up in rural Illinois as a farm boy, with his trusty companion Leonard the dachshund by his side. He eventually left the farm to obtain a BS in Economics, followed by an MA in Behavioral Psychology. Discover powerful ways to stop ruminating and dwelling on negative thoughts, including how to be aware of your negative spiral triggers, identify and recognize your inner anxieties, keep the focus on relaxation and action, and learn proven methods to overcome stress attacks. Declutter your mind and find focus. Unleash your unlimited potential and start living.
